Nghi Vo has genuinely some of the most beautiful writing I've ever encountered, and I'm so glad to have finally read this novella! I usually tend towards longer fantasy, but I absolutely loved this shorter piece and feel that it made fantastic use of its length to be impactful. I loved Chih's careful categorization of the objects around them and the way this beautiful description led us into the story of Rabbit and the Empress in the past. Each woman's story is full of exactly the right details to create a powerful impression of the challenges she faces while also maintaining a perfect sense of atmosphere and mystery. The fact that Rabbit is recounting the past allows for hints at how things will play out at the end of a tale that's already been finished, creating a strong sense of building tension throughout the work. Such a short book actually made me tear up more than once, the struggles of these two women and their companions within this fraught political atmosphere and beautiful world were absolutely so moving. The reveal at the end was absolutely perfect, too--I was expecting it by that point, but in a way that felt completely satisfying and inevitable for the story.
I just loved this novella! I enjoyed that Vo trusts the reader to adapt to this fantasy world and figure things out as we go along, and overall keeps things pretty subtle. This was just such a powerful piece of writing, and I cannot wait to keep reading the rest of the novellas in this series!
